Course Details
• Advanced HTML & CSS: Understanding the basics of HTML and CSS is crucial for advanced web development. This unit will cover advanced topics such as Flexbox, Grid system, and responsive design.
• Bootstrap Framework: This unit will focus on the Bootstrap framework, its components, and how to use it for responsive web development. It will include hands-on exercises and projects to help learners master the framework.
• Advanced CSS: This unit will cover advanced CSS techniques such as CSS animations, transitions, and responsive design. It will also cover preprocessors such as SASS and LESS.
• JavaScript & jQuery: This unit will cover the basics of JavaScript and jQuery. It will include topics such as DOM manipulation, events, and animations.
• Advanced JavaScript: This unit will cover advanced JavaScript concepts such as closures, promises, async/await, and ES6 features. It will also cover popular libraries and frameworks such as React and Angular.
• Testing & Debugging: This unit will cover best practices for testing and debugging web applications. It will include topics such as unit testing, integration testing, and debugging tools.
• Deployment & Maintenance: This unit will cover best practices for deploying and maintaining web applications. It will include topics such as version control, deployment strategies, and serverless architecture.
• Web Security: This unit will cover best practices for securing web applications. It will include topics such as authentication, authorization, and encryption.
• Web Performance: This unit will cover best practices for optimizing web application performance. It will include topics such as caching, minification, and compression.
